Question 8 (4 points) We define a round as one RTT time. Consider a TCP Reno sender with initial CWND = 1MSS and assume the RWND is infinite. Suppose the initial ss_thresh = 16MSS. Assume no packet losses. At the end of round 1 or the beginning of round 2, CWND = 2MSS. The sender enters congestion avoidance phase at the beginning of round A . Assume no packet losses, the CWND at the end of round 6 is A MSS. Assume two packets are lost at the beginning of round 6. Immediately after the detection of packet losses, CWND equals A MSS and ss_threshold equals A MSS
